BREAKFAST OF A CHAMPION

Ingredients:
1 cup of water
1/2 cup of oats (Bob's Red Mill of course)
1/2 banana
2 tbsp of Shelled Hemp Seeds
1-2 tbsp of Almond Butter (YUM)
1-2 tbsp of Pure Maple Syrup

1.) Cook oatmeal according to directions (about 10 minutes) until all the water is absorbed
2.) Chop banana and add it to oatmeal
3.) Add in Shelled hemp seeds, Almond butter, and pure maple syrup
4.) EAT! (See why I love this recipe, EASY. Plus, champions got to go to work!)

REASONS WHY I LOVE THIS DISH
1.) Oats (unprocessed! Instant or quick 2 minute oat do NOT count!) take a long time to digest and are a great substance to keep blood sugars level. They also are very good at hydrating the body because of the water they have absorbed in the cooking process.

2.) Shelled hemp seeds provide ample protein to feed your starving muscles.

3.) The hemp seed consist mainly of oil (typically 44% and 33% protein) providing the body with essential fatty acids. The seeds also contain a very good source of vitamin E and fiber.

4.) Almond butter is a nutritional powerhouses that contain significant amounts of protein, calcium, fiber, magnesium, folic acid, potassium, and vitamin E. Almond butter has extremely low saturated fat content and is rich in monounsaturated fats making it a heart-healthy choice

5.)Maple syrup is sweet - and we're not just talking flavor. Maple syrup, as an excellent source of manganese and a good source of zinc, can also be sweet for your health.

The trace mineral maganese is an essential cofactor in a number of enzymes important in energy production and antioxidant defenses. For example, the key oxidative enzyme superoxide dismutase, which disarms free radicals produced within the mitochondria (the energy production factories within our cells), requires manganese. One ounce of maple syrup supplies 22.0% of the daily value for this very important trace mineral.
